Another song along the same vain of "Money on the Radio." I truly feel that kids have it bad right now with everything that is going on in our economy. They are forced to listen to terrible music and are all slaves to their cell phones and video games. The fist verse of the song is about the rise of children obesity. "You rarely say you're hungry but I always find you searching for food." Sadly, children aren't the only ones that are struggling today. Without rock and roll, without a revolt, we are all in trouble. - Duane Okun
